Insights into organelle forming RNAs: Diversity, functions and future perspectives

open access: yesAnimal Models and Experimental Medicine, EarlyView.
RNA molecules play crucial roles in the formation and maintenance of cellular structures and organelles. These ‘organelle formation RNAs’ include ribosomal RNAs, paraspeckle‐forming RNAs, nuclear speckle‐forming RNAs, nucleolus‐forming RNAs, and cytoskeleton‐forming RNA.

Trametinib in Adults with Neurofibromatosis Type 1‐Related Symptomatic Plexiform Neurofibromas

open access: yesAnnals of Neurology, EarlyView.
Objective Mitogen‐activated protein kinase kinase inhibitors have shown promising results in treatment of plexiform neurofibromas in neurofibromatosis type 1 patients, but data in adults are limited. The aim of this phase 2 study was to investigate the efficacy and safety of trametinib in adults with neurofibromatosis type 1.

Acoustofluidic Patterning for Improved Microtissue Histology

open access: yesAdvanced NanoBiomed Research, EarlyView.
Microtissue histology is widely used to characterize microtissue phenotype and morphology. However, conventional microtissue histology workflows are inefficient and time‐consuming. This work introduces a novel embedding technique that uses acoustofluidics to improve the efficiency of microtissue histology and reduce the time required for data analysis.

A New Era for Using Natural Pigments: The Case of the C50 Carotenoid Called Bacterioruberin

open access: yesBiotechnology and Applied Biochemistry, EarlyView.
ABSTRACT Haloarchaea are extremophilic microorganisms belonging to the Archaea domain that require high salt concentrations to live, thus inhabiting ecosystems like salty ponds, salty marshes, or extremely salty lagoons. They are more abundant and widely distributed worldwide than initially expected.
